Truth Hackers - Episode Four: Religious Realities

Episode Four: Religious Realities

01/02/21 • 24 min

Truth Hackers
It should be a simple question. Do you believe in god, or are you an atheist? A lot of people all over the world say they believe in god, but do they all believe the same way? Does believing in god mean one thing, or is not believing as varied as believing?
The problem with an atheism versus religion approach is that locks us into a false choice. Faith versus evidence. The seen versus the unseen. To divide the world like this, you have to cut your soul in two and throw half of it away. We can do better than that.
